Ok maybe I'm just a stupid noob but I can't figure out what happened here:

  1. Started salvaging corvette components

  2. Bought a landing gear and hab module but couldn't afford/find a cockpit yet

  3. Started designing a corvette anyway, saved the half-finished design for later

  4. Went back now that I salvage a cockpit, game says I have no saved designs and the parts I bought are not in my inventory or Corvette Workshop storage

Did I screw myself by trying to save an invalid design?

did you go back to the corvette workshop in the same space station that you started it from?

I found that if I change stations while there is an incomplete design, it will not follow me to the next station. Once I finished a new design, my old parts ended up in the cache box.
